The HR Leave of Absence Administrator provides support for FMLA, Worker’s Compensation and Unemployment Compensation for all employees. This role effectively coordinates these processes to include process administration and program compliance with all related employment laws. The HR Leave of Absence Administrator performs exemplary customer service and assistance; develops, implements and evaluates ongoing strategies related to managing leaves of absence effectively.

Responsibilities

  • Administers Family & Medical Leave Act policy including fielding all inquiries, communications, with employees, supervisors, etc.
  • Administers Workers Compensation including inquiries, vendor management and communication relating to injuries.
  • Administers Unemployment Compensation, acts as the liaison with Vendor, ADP and HR Managers; collect pertinent data to provide to hearing officer
  • Serves as the subject matter expert for FMLA, WC, UC & all other leaves in alignment and under the general direction and guidance of HR leadership.
  • Monitors completion of necessary FMLA and leaves documentation and provides appropriate notification during each the stage of the leave process.
  • Reviews employee leave requests to determine eligibility and certification in compliance with company policies as well as state and federal leave laws.
  • Administers Family Medical Leave Act to include tracking hours used/taken for intermittent leave and works closely with the Payroll department to ensure that pay is accurate and correct.
  • Communicates absences, accommodations and return to work information as appropriate to employees and relevant supervisors/managers & HR Team for follow up.
  • Manage Workers Compensation claims from initial injury reporting through claim resolution, ensuring timely reporting of workplace injuries and submission or required documentation
  • Administer unemployment insurance claims, including responding to requests and confirming employment status
  • Educate employees and managers on leave policies, procedures, and leave requirements. Stay informed about changes to leave laws, FMLA, Worker’s Compensation Information, Unemployment Compensation and HR best practices
